As is my usual, I was surfing about the web this evening and came into contact with a pet peeve... a frightening film that reveals just how demented and dangerous certain folks are in this country and why...
WARNING: This material may make you pissed, nauseated, disgusted and wishing there were ways to file child abuse charges against these ass holes.